Table 1 Table summarizing CCB and PCB characteristics after batch cell bank production in terms of production conditions, identity, and purity: (i) the conditions of preparation for CCB and PCB, i.e. medium types and oxygenation, (ii) the parameters used to verify that bacterial identity is maintained while switching from the CCB and PCB, i.e. comparison of cell size, cell morphology, cytometry spectra, number of magnetosomes per cell, mean magnetosome size, magnetosome size distribution, multiplex PCR of MSR1 16S RNA, between CCB and PCB, (iii) the parameters highlighting bacterial purity in PCB and CCB, i.e. bacterial integrity established by cultivating MSR1 bacteria on LB agar plate and observation of a suspension of MSR1 bacteria to verify the absence of contaminants

From: Set-up of a pharmaceutical cell bank of Magnetospirillum gryphiswaldense MSR1 magnetotactic bacteria producing highly pure magnetosomes
